I hand wash my headgear with dawn scent-free detergent and about a half cup of vinegar, same as what I use to wash my hoses and humidifier. I let it soak for awhile. I lay the headgear flat to air-dry on a washcloth till night, then throw it into the dryer to finish the drying and shrinking. Smells fresh, too.

Headgear and microfleece strap liners in laundry bag in washer with sensitive-skin Persil (enzymes help clean). Then hang 'em up to air dry. I was soaking and then washing with Dawn but I'd forget and then had wet headgear making me use an older set that caused leaks. Now I kept a clean set of strap liners and headgear in a baggie.
